    My Dad told me that during WWII that his only mode of transportation was shoe leather, but with the uniform on he didn't have to walk far before someone would see him and pick him up. He said it was that way no matter what part of the country he happened to be.

As i saw the later take on the story... the school has a policy against "Camo' on ALL persons........ Not uniforms, military or others.....

He came to the school; wearing his desert Camo Fatigues .......

Had he been in his Dress Uniform there would have been no problem.......

Once again... something taken out of context......

Also, upon further reading....

The school stated that there is no policy at all against uniforms.... the "for hire" security guards misinterpreted the policy on campus and told him to go home and change.

Tempest in a Tea Pot.....
